Engine light is on yellow perminantly and when i put the key on and turn the electrics on but not fireing up the engine the EML light stays on too? Once the the engine has stared up the EML goes off the engine light stays on but the car seems to have lost power it runs but does not seem as responsive?

These lights are computer readings. When a sensor reading goes bad, it tells the computer, then lights up the dash light. What you need to do is go to your local Advance Auto, or Auto Zone and ask for a computer diaglosic test. They will do it for free. If you have a car that they can not plug in to like a Ferrari, then you should go to your car brand's dealership. A diagnostic test will tell you exactly what sensor is reading trouble and send you down the right path to repair instead of running around.

What will make my 1998 ford explorer turn over but not start. no fire in coil. we changed the coil and still no fire. checked all fuses, their fine. checked fuel pump- we can hear it kick on when key is...

Put key in IGN and turn to run. All warning lights should come on, including the check engine light. Then turn the key to crank. As the engine cranks and the crankshaft position sensor detects rotation and reports it to the PCM, the check engine light should go out. If it stays on, the PCM isn't getting input from the crankshaft postion sensor. Check the connection or replace the sensor.

Maintenance reqd light came on at 44,000 miles...why?

It's probably your regular scheduled maintenance (oil change) light. Here's how you can reset that:

1. Turn the key to "on" so the electrical system is fired up (but engine is not running)

2. Set trip planner to "A" trip.

3. Turn key off (no electrical)

4. Hold down trip button, then turn key to "on" so the electrical system is fired up (but engine is not running).

5. "Maint Req" light will blink several times and then go off.

Eml on my mini coopers

the engine control unit has detected a fault light illuminated which in turn reduces ability to gain high revs as a damage limitation exercise , known as limp home , car requires diagnostic computer to check fault codes to indicate faulty component causing ecu to go into limp home mode
